Abdul Alim Meaning in English
EnglishAbdul Alim
Abdul Alim is an Arabic name meaning 'Slave of the All-Knowing'. It combines 'Abd' (servant) with 'Al-Alim', one of Allah's names meaning The All-Knowing, The Omniscient. This name emphasizes Allah's complete and perfect knowledge of all things. The Quran frequently mentions Al-Alim to remind believers of Allah's awareness of their actions and intentions. This name encourages seeking knowledge while acknowledging that true, complete knowledge belongs to Allah alone.
